Morphological Transitions of Vesicles Induced by Alternating Electric Fields

When subjected to alternating electric fields in the frequency range 10(2)–10(8) Hz, giant lipid vesicles attain oblate, prolate, and spherical shapes and undergo morphological transitions between these shapes as one varies the field frequency and/or the conductivities λ(in) and λ(ex) of the aqueous...
